Docker修改网络模式默认启动教程
作为一名经验丰富的开发者,你需要教会一位刚入行的小白如何实现“docker修改网络模式默认启动”。以下是整个流程的详细步骤,并附带每一步需要执行的代码和注释。
整个流程的步骤
首先,我们来展示整个流程的步骤。下表将展示每个步骤的顺序和描述信息。
步骤 | 描述 |
---|---|
1 | 检查系统中是否已安装Docker |
2 | 创建一个Dockerfile |
3 | 在Dockerfile中定义修改网络模式的指令 |
4 | 构建Docker镜像 |
5 | 运行Docker容器 |
步骤1:检查系统中是否已安装Docker
在命令行中执行以下命令,以确认你的系统中是否已经安装Docker:
docker --version
如果你已经安装了Docker,将会显示Docker的版本信息。
步骤2:创建一个Dockerfile
创建一个名为Dockerfile的文件,并使用你喜欢的代码编辑器打开它。Dockerfile用于构建Docker镜像。
touch Dockerfile
步骤3:在Dockerfile中定义修改网络模式的指令
在Dockerfile中,你需要添加一些指令来修改网络模式。以下是一个示例Dockerfile文件:
# 使用基础镜像
FROM ubuntu
# 安装需要的软件
RUN apt-get update && \
apt-get install -y <your-required-packages>
# 设置默认的网络模式
CMD ["dockerd", "--default-network", "bridge"]
在上述示例中,你需要将<your-required-packages>
替换为你希望安装的软件包列表。CMD
指令用于设置默认的网络模式为"bridge"。
步骤4:构建Docker镜像
使用以下命令在命令行中构建Docker镜像:
docker build -t <image-name> .
上述命令中的<image-name>
应替换为你希望为镜像设置的名称。
步骤5:运行Docker容器
最后一步是运行Docker容器,以便应用你所定义的网络模式修改。使用以下命令在命令行中运行Docker容器:
docker run -it <image-name>
上述命令中的<image-name>
应替换为你之前为镜像设置的名称。
至此,你已经成功地教会了这位刚入行的小白如何实现“docker修改网络模式默认启动”。通过上述步骤,他可以轻松地完成这个任务。
引用形式的描述信息
Docker是一种流行的容器化平台,用于管理和部署应用程序。通过修改Docker的网络模式,你可以自定义容器的网络行为,以适应不同的场景和需求。上述教程提供了一种简单的方法来修改Docker容器的默认网络模式。通过遵循这些步骤,你可以轻松地实现这个任务并加深对Docker的理解。